Popularity of Higher Education/Higher Education Administration at MBU

In 2021, 5 students received their master’s degree in higher education/higher education administration from MBU. This makes it the #155 most popular school for higher education/higher education administration master’s degree candidates in the country.

MBU Higher Education/Higher Education Administration Master’s Program

Of the 5 students who graduated with a Master’s in higher education/higher education administration from MBU in 2021, 20% were men and 80% were women.

undefined

The majority of master's degree recipients in this major at MBU are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 100% of students fell into this category.
